Approval of IU formula
IU approved its presidential ticket with Alfonso Barrantes Lingán as candidate and Jorge del Prado Chávez and Luis Nieto as vice presidents, but it was reformulated 36 hours later.
The Izquierda Unida (IU) formula for the presidential elections was approved in the early morning of October 9, 1984. The formula included the presidential candidacy of Alfonso Barrantes Lingán, with the vice-presidencies of Jorge del Prado Chávez and Luis Nieto. However, this formula barely lasted 36 hours and was reformulated, although the presidential candidacy of Alfonso Barrantes Lingán was maintained.
